Pagination in the Lorvane public API uses opaque cursors, never page numbers. If a customer reports missing records, first confirm they are passing the cursor from the previous response unmodified; truncated cursors silently reset to page one. Rate limits apply per cursor chain. The full decision tree for pagination tickets is documented here.

operations page: https://confluence.qorvellabs.internal/pages/projects/projects/projects

This ticket covers swapping the default dispatch heuristic in the LiftPath elevator simulator from nearest-car to destination-batching. The change affects all benchmark scenarios shipped with the Harbridge Tower demo, so expect baseline numbers to shift. As a contractor, you can implement and test the change, but you cannot merge it yourself. Run the full scenario suite, attach the before/after throughput numbers, and request sign-off. The sign-off authority for this ticket is listed below.

named custodian: Brivan Eliath Quenox Frador

Ticket: Config drift on Quartzpress incremental builds

So the incremental static site rebuilds have been flaky again, and it turns out staging and prod drifted apart sometime last quarter — staging still does full rebuilds on every push while prod only rebuilds changed pages. Nobody noticed because the cache papered over it. Future maintainers: please keep both environments pinned to the same settings. For the record, the intended canonical configuration is as follows.

service settings:
PRAIX_LOG_LEVEL=error
PRAIX_METRICS_HOST=metrics.praix.qorvelcorp.corp
PRAIX_POOL_SIZE=16

## Releases

Gridloom ships a tagged build every other Thursday. Cut the tag from `main`, run `make release`, and the pipeline builds the crossword generator binaries for all three targets. Artifacts land in the Loomcrate bucket under the version number. Nothing goes out unsigned — the pipeline rejects unsigned tarballs automatically. Verification instructions live in `docs/verify.md`. New team members: read that doc before your first release. The current release signing key is:

signing key of tawig-yagep = bky4_HQEP